Check out these five facts from the matchday 10 of the English Premier League
Advertisement

1. West Ham 2 Vs Chelsea 1: Bad times for Jose Mourinho

Advertisement

Chelsea lost their fifth game of the season in Matchday 10, falling 1-2 away at West Ham.

That loss is Jose Mourinho’s sixth defeat in 12 league games.

Before that, he suffered just six losses in 64 league games.

2. Leicester City 1 Vs Crystal Palace 0: Inform Vardy

Leicester City striker Jamie Vardy netted his 10th goal of this season and is seventh and seven straight league games.

He becomes just the eighth player to maintain that streak.

With 10 goals so far this season, Vardy has scored more than five sides in the league.

3. Liverpool 1 Vs Southampton 1: Misfiring Kops

Liverpool could only manage a 1-1 draw with Southampton and are yet without a win under Jürgen Klopp.

They have 62 shots on goal in three games under the German coach but have just scored two goals from them.

4. Sunderland 3 Vs Newcastle United 0: One-sided derby

Sunderland trashed Newcastle United 3-0 making it their sixth straight win in the Wear-Tyne derby.

The Magpies have managed just one goal in 627 minutes against the Black Cats

5. Manchester United 0 Vs Manchester City 0: Lackluster derby

Manchester United and rivals City settled for a goalless draw, the third in the derby history.

That was also City's first in their last 69 league games.
